Oddo BHF Asset Management Sas Increases Stake in Walmart Inc. $WMT

Oddo BHF Asset Management Sas increased its position in shares of Walmart Inc. (NASDAQ:WMTFree Report) by 24.2% during the fourth qu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the SEC. The institutional investor owned 107,737 shares of the retailer’s stock after buying an additional 20,969 shares during the period. Oddo BHF Asset Management Sas’ holdings in Walmart were worth $12,003,000 as of its most recent filing with the SEC.

Walmart Stock Performance

NASDAQ WMT opened at $121.03 on Wednesday. The company has a market cap of $963.17 billion, a PE ratio of 42.47,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 4.51 and a beta of 0.59. The stock’s 50 day simple moving average is $125.09 and its 200-day simple moving average is $121.96. Walmart Inc. has a 1-year low of $93.62 and a 1-year high of $135.15.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.42, a current ratio of 0.77 and a quick ratio of 0.23.

Walmart (NASDAQ:WMTGet Free Report) last released its earnings results on Thursday, May 21st. The retailer reported $0.66 earnings per share for the quarter, meeting the consensus estimate of $0.66. The business had revenue of $177.75 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$174.84 billion. Walmart had a return on equity of 21.25% and a net margin of 3.13%.The business’s quarterly revenue was up 7.4%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ter last year, the business posted $0.61 earnings per share. Walmart has set its FY 2027 guidance at 2.750-2.850 EPS and its Q2 2027 guidance at 0.720-0.740 EPS. As a group, equities research analysts anticipate that Walmart Inc. will post 2.89 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Walmart Profile

(Free Report)

Walmart is a multinational retail corporation that operates a broad portfolio of store formats and digital services. Its core business includes large-format supercenters, discount department stores, neighborhood grocery stores and a membership warehouse chain, Sam’s Club. The company’s merchandising mix covers groceries, household goods, apparel, electronics and pharmacy services, supplemented by private-label products and category-specific offerings. Walmart pairs its physical store network with online platforms and mobile applications to provide omnichannel shopping, fulfillment and delivery options for consumers and businesses.

The company was founded by Sam Walton, who opened the first store in Rogers, Arkansas in 1962; it is headquartered in Bentonville, Arkansas.
